1956 Italian Grand Prix.
Monza, Italy. 31/8-2/9 1956.
Juan Manuel Fangio (in Peter Collins' Lancia-Ferrari D50 801), 2nd position, clinching the World Championship for the fourth time. Collins handed his car over to Fangio after the latter had retired, thus giving Fangio the title.

1956 Italian Grand Prix.
Monza, Italy. 31/8-2/9 1956.
Juan Manuel Fangio (Lancia-Ferrari D50) leads Stirling Moss (Maserati 250F) and Peter Collins (Lancia-Ferrari D50). Fangio later took over Collins' car to clinch his fourth World Championship after his developed technical problems. Moss finished in 1st position.
